Ion 'Jon' Erice Domínguez (born 3 November 1986 in Pamplona, Navarre) is a Spanish professional footballer who plays for Real Oviedo as a midfielder.

Football career

A CA Osasuna's youth graduate, Erice appeared in nine first-team games in his first two seasons combined, the first coming on 1 April 2007 in a 0–0 La Liga home draw against Sevilla FC (90 minutes played). However, he finished the following campaign on loan to second division's Málaga CF, contributing with five matches to the Andalusia side's top flight return.

Erice was loaned again in 2008–09, now to SD Huesca, freshly promoted to the second level. However, in January 2009, he was released by the Navarrese, signing a one and a half-year contract with division three club Cádiz CF although a loan was initially projected, and appearing in ten contests for another promotion.

Erice was an undisputed starter throughout the 2009–10 season – 36 games, 2,696 minutes – but Cádiz was immediately relegated back, after finishing 19th.
